Abstract

This paper presents a new multiphase image segmentation model based on Fuzzy Region Competition. The proposed model approximates image regions by probability density functions and uses a supervised approach in the segmentation process. The strategy of the proposed model is to perform a two-phase Fuzzy Region Competition model iteratively for image segmentation. The hard partition is obtained in each step from a determined fuzzy membership functions consequently, the segmentation process is soft, while the final result is hard, due to the simplicity of avoiding non-overlapping and vacuum regions. Finally, several experiments on multiphase images are presented to demonstrate the efficiency and robustness of the proposed model when dealing with noisy, texturized and natural images.
